I-LOS ANGELES (Dec. 1, 2018) - UDeontay “The Bronze Bomber” Wilder kanye noTyson “The Gypsy King” Fury balwe kwaze kwaphuma isinqumo sokuhlukana nge-SHOWTIME PPV® ngoMgqibelo ebusuku bevela e-STAPLES Center, ngokungangabazeki enye yezimpi ezingcono kakhulu ze-heavyweight eminyakeni edlule.
Ngemuva kokulawula impi yeWBC World Championship kusenesikhathi, Ukufutheka (27-0-1, 19 Kos) wanqoba ngokuyisimangaliso ama- knockdown amabili kaWilder (40-0-1, 39 Kos) – okuhlanganisa eyodwa emzuliswaneni 12 - emdwebeni ongenakwenzeka. Abahluleli igoli iziqubu 115-111 ngoWilder, 114-112 for Fury kanye 113-113.
“Ngicabanga ukuthi ngokushaywa kwemingqimuzo emibili nakanjani ngiyinqobile impi,” kusho uWilder, oqophe i- knockdown ngayinye yakhe 41 Izimpi zodumo futhi ubevikela ibhande lakhe le-WBC okwesishiyagalombili kusukela lapho 2015. “Sithulule izinhliziyo zethu namhlanje ebusuku. Sobabili singamaqhawe, kodwa ngalawa maconsi amabili ngicabanga ukuthi ngiyinqobile impi.”
UFury wabona ngenye indlela, esho ukuthi wayinika konke anakho.
“Sisendaweni engaphandle, Ngiwiswe phansi kabili, kodwa ngisakholwa ukuthi ngiyinqobile leyo mpi,” kusho uFury wase-England, ukubuya kwakhe okumangalisayo kuyaqhubeka kulandela iminyaka emibili nesigamu engekho kulo mdlalo ekuluthweni izidakamizwa notshwala kanye nezinkinga zempilo yengqondo.. Bengingeke ngiwiswe phansi namhlanje ebusuku. Ngikhombise inhliziyo enhle ukusukuma. Ngize lapha ebusuku futhi ngalwa nenhliziyo yami.”
Bekuwubusuku obumnandi njengoba kumenyezelwe ukuthi kuzoba khona 17,698 fans, eyayihlanganisa izinkanyezi zaseHollywood futhi ilwa nabalandeli abafana nabaphambili beLakers uShaquille O'Neal, UJerry West, izihlabani ze-NFL uMichael Strahan noMichael Irvin, nezingqalabutho zesibhakela u-Evander Holyfield noFloyd Mayweather.
Ukufutheka, owashiya uWilder 84-71 jikelele, ubanjwe isandla esifushane sokudla uWilder ngemuva nje kwendlebe yangakwesokunxele ukuze awise uFury okwesithathu emsebenzini wakhe emzuliswaneni wesishiyagalolunye.. Kwathi ngo-12, inhlanganisela ye-Wilder yesandla sokudla nehhuku yesokunxele ithumele i-6-foot-9 Fury phansi futhi, eshaya ikhanda phezu kweseyili. Again, ukwazile ukusukuma unompempe uJack Reiss wamvumela ukuthi aqhubeke nokulwa.
“Isibhakela sihlezi siyishashalazi yabantu abebengalindelekile, futhi yilokho ebesinakho kulobubusuku,” kusho umhlaziyi ongungoti we-SHOWTIME u-Al Bernstein.
UBernstein uthe ukubona uFury esukuma eqhubeka nokulwa ngemuva kokushaywa ngesihluku “kungenye yezinto ezimangaza kakhulu engake ngazibona eringini yesibhakela.”
Usomlando wesibhakela we-SHOWTIME nomhlaziyi uSteve Farhood wayenoFury elawula imizuliswano yokuqala nemizuliswano yokuwina uFury 3-8, futhi ekugcineni wahola impi, 115-111.
Ngenxa yesigatshana sokuphikisana, bobabili abalwi babuzwa ukuthi bangathanda yini ukuphinda. “Ngingathanda ukuthi kube yimpi yami elandelayo,” kusho uWilder. "Kungani kungenjalo? Ake sinikeze abalandeli lokho abafuna ukukubona. Bekuyimpi enkulu futhi masikwenze futhi. Akusho lutho kimina lapho sikwenza khona.”
“Amaphesenti ayikhulu sizokwenza impinda,” kusho uFury, ukulwa empini yokuqala yebhande le-heavyweight ekhokhelwayo eMelika kusukela 2002. “Singompetha ababili abakhulu. Mina nale ndoda singama-heavyweight amabili ahamba phambili emhlabeni.”
UWilder uthe uphume kancane waphuthuma izibhakela zakhe. “Angizange ngihlale phansi. Ngangimanqika kakhulu. Ngaqala ukuketula isandla sokudla futhi angikwazanga ukuzijwayeza.”
Ukufutheka, elwa okwesithathu kulo nyaka nomqeqeshi oneminyaka engu-26 uBen Davison ekhoneni lakhe, ubuye waba nomdlali wesibhakela owayengumdlali wesibhakela u-Ricky Hatton kanye nomqeqeshi wonyaka amahlandla ayisikhombisa uFreddie Roach ekhoneni lakhe.

Former Wilder foe and heavyweight southpaw Luis “The Real King Kong” Ortiz (30-1, 26 Kos) returned to STAPLES Center for a second consecutive victory with a resounding 10th-round TKO against Travis “My Time” Kauffman (32-3, 23 Kos) of Reading, Pa.
The 39-year-old Ortiz of Camaguey, Cuba, registered left-cross knockdowns in the sixth, eighth and 10th rounds before the final blow coming later in the 10th round against a gritty Kauffman. It was the 26th career stoppage for Ortiz, who lost to Wilder in a Fight of the Year candidate back in March.
The fight was officially called at 1:58 of the 10th round. "Ngingumfana iqhawe,” Ortiz said. “Nothing contains me. We didn’t have to knock him out but we wanted to show everything we have in our repertoire, and we showed it tonight.”
Ortiz, who was warned twice for low blows, clipped Kauffman for a second time by a lethal left hand of Ortiz at 2:29 in the round lwesishiyagalombili. But just like the first time he was send to canvas in the sixth round, Kauffman was able to get up and continue fighting.
The technically sound performance by Ortiz included 376 jab attempts to Kauffman’s 99 and out-landing him 66-7. That led to a 135-37 lead in total connects and a 69-30 margin in power connects against Kauffman, who SHOWTIME commentator Paulie Malignaggi called, “a stubborn guy who wouldn’t go away.”
“Of course I’ll fight the winner of this fight [Wilder-Fury],” Ortiz said. “I want that second fight with Wilder. I want to fight anybody.”
In the pay-per-view telecast opener, Joe “The Juggernaut” Joyce (7-0, 7 Kos) recorded a massive first-round knockout against Joe “The Future” Hanks (23-3, 15 Kos). A rising heavyweight, Joyce, kusukela London, England, ended the fight officially after just 2:25 as he used a right jab to set up a near-perfect left hook sending Hanks to the canvas and down for the count.
Trained by noted trainer Abel Sanchez, Joyce told Gray he’s ready for anyone. “I want to get in some bigger fights,” said the former Olympic silver medal winner who recorded his fourth first-round KO. “I’ve been doing well so there is plenty more to come. All the support from back home in England, thanks for coming. I hope I put on something good to watch.”
It was the second win in the United States for Joyce, who also picked up the vacant WBA Continental heavyweight title. “I’m getting people out quickly,"Uthe. “I’ve got a lot of experience, I’m just going to improve on my strength and my speed. I’ve heard comments that I’m slow but I seem to land the shots and get the job done.”
It was the third time during his career that Hanks, from Newark, N.J., has been knocked down by a left hook.
